As Flow Assurance engineer you will work on thermo-hydraulic and fluids management studies for all different streams in the energy sector, whether it is oil & gas or Energy Transition related fluids like CO2, H2, and Ammonia. You will support energy transport networks definition but also define operating philosophies and liaise with connected disciplines such as process, pipelines, and safety. You will therefore be involved in major projects in subsea, offshore or onshore sectors tackling key topics such as optimisation of design to reduce cost, assess feasibility of CCUS, and define safest operating strategies, etc.
